实验性铬酸钠中毒大鼠肾溶菌酶变化的研究

摘    要:通过免疫组化和图像分析对实验性铬酸钠中毒大鼠肾溶菌酶变化进行了研究。结果显示:铬中毒后,近曲小管上皮细胞中溶菌酶变化最为明显。一次气管内注入0.008mg/kg铬酸钠2天后,近曲小管上皮细胞中溶菌酶含量即较对照组升高,并随着剂量的加大而进一步升高。一次注入0.98mg/kg铬酸钠后第2天即较对照组升高,二周内持续升高,第14天达高峰,随后随着肾损伤的修复逐渐降低。结果说明:溶菌酶可作为近曲小管上皮细胞损伤的一个早期敏感指标来研究铬等重金属的肾毒性作用。

A STUDY ON THE CHANGE OF LYSOZYME IN KIDNEYS OF RATS TREATED BY CHROMATE SODIUM

Abstract:The chance of lysozyme in kidneys of rats treated by chromate sodium was studied by means of immunohistochernistry and image analysis. The most significant change of lysozyme was foulld to be present in the epithelium of proximal tubule. The large dose of chromate sodium, the higher the quantity of lysozyme compared with control group, the quantity of lysozyme increased on the second and third day after once administration of chromate sodium through intratrachea with the dose of 0. 98mg/kg and 0. 008mg/kg respectively, it increased further more within the following two weeks and reached to the peak value on the fourteenth day in the 0. 98mg/kg dose group. With the rehabilitation of epithelium of proximal tubule from the damage, the quantity of lysozyme decreased gradually. The results illustrated that the lysozyme could be used as an early sensitive marker of the damage in the epithelium of proximal tubule in the study of the nephrotoxic effects of chromium and other heavy metals.
